The lock is an additional element of a uPVC door. Snapping locks became a problem a few years ago and the police raised awareness by launching an awareness campaign across the country. Since then, the majority of uPVC manufacturers have improved their lock cylinders to resist this issue. They have also developed anti-drilling and anti-bumping technologies to ensure your security.
You can further enhance your uPVC door's security by adding additional locking devices. These devices come in different designs and can be used on both uPVC and composite doors. Some of the most sought-after options are sash jammers, hinge bolts and door chains. In addition to providing additional security, these tools can reduce your energy bills by preventing drafts from entering and air or heat from getting out.
